District staff reported about 3,000 students attended 2025 summer programs, with notable gains on middle-school pre/post tests and credit-recovery results. A public hearing to evaluate accelerated instruction effectiveness had no public speakers.

Mesquite ISD presented results of its 2025 summer learning and accelerated-instruction programs to the board on Sept. 16, reporting attendance, meal counts and measurable academic gains on short-term pre/post assessments.
